Form 4: HF Sinclair Director Franklin Myers Acquires RSUs
Insider Transaction Report
HF Sinclair Director Franklin Myers reported the acquisition of 2,943 restricted stock units, increasing his beneficial ownership to 157,008 shares.
Summary
- Franklin Myers, a Director of HF Sinclair Corp (DINO), acquired 2,943 shares of common stock.
- The transaction date for this acquisition was November 12, 2025.
- The shares were acquired at a price of $0, indicating they are restricted stock units (RSUs) as part of an incentive plan.
- Following this transaction, Mr. Myers beneficially owns a total of 157,008 shares of HF Sinclair Corp common stock.
- These restricted stock units were granted under the HF Sinclair Corporation Amended and Restated 2020 Long Term Incentive Plan.
- The restrictions on these RSUs are scheduled to lapse on December 1, 2026 (or the first business day thereafter if it falls on a weekend).
- Vesting is contingent upon Mr. Myers' continued service on the board of directors from the grant date until the vesting date.
- Unless settlement is deferred, the vested restricted stock units will be paid in the form of the Issuer's common stock within 30 days following the vesting date.
